For viral metagenomic analysis, 50 feces samples were collected from 30 patients with atopic dermatitis and 20 health child who were admitted to the Department of Dermatology and Venerology of the Affiliated Hospital of Jiangsu University from Sep 2017 to Aug 2018. The mean age of study participants was 10.5 (8-13) years. The average courses were 3.263.14 month (1 week to 15 months). The 50 feces were randomly pooled into 50 specimen pools, each including 1 feces. The feces pools were individually homogenized with a mortar and pestle, resuspended in 1 mL DPBS, and then frozen and thawed rapidly three times on dry-ice. The supernatants were then collected after centrifugation (10 min, 15,000 g). Supernatants were filtered through a 0.45-mm filter (Millipore) to remove eukaryotic- and bacterial cell-sized particles, and 200 uL of supernatant from each pool was then subjected to a mixture of nuclease enzymes to reduce the concentration of free (non-viral encapsidated) nucleic acids[13,14]. Remaining total nucleic acid was then isolated using QIAamp MinElute Virus Spin Kit according to manufacturer's protocol. Eleven libraries were then constructed using Nextera XT DNA Sample Preparation Kit (Illumina) and sequenced using the MiSeq Illumina platform with 250 bases paired ends with dual barcoding for each pool.
